What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in Operations, and why are they important?

To thrive in Operations, you need strong analytical skills, process optimization abilities, and experience in supply chain or project management,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with ERP systems, workflow management tools, and certifications like Six Sigma are commonly expected. Excellent problem-solving, leadership, and communication skills help drive efficiency and foster collaboration across teams. These competencies are vital for ensuring streamlined processes, minimizing costs, and achieving organizational objectives.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in operations roles, and how can they be effectively managed?

Professionals in operations often face challenges such as coordinating across multiple departments, adapting to fast-changing priorities, and optimizing processes under tight deadlines. Effective management of these challenges typically involves strong communication skills, proactive problem-solving, and the ability to use data to inform decisions. Building strong relationships with team members and leveraging project management tools can also help operations professionals stay organized and ensure smooth workflow. Continuous learning and adaptability are essential to thrive in this dynamic environment.

What are 'Operations' jobs?

Operations jobs focus on managing and optimizing the day-to-day activities within a business to ensure efficiency and productivity. Professionals in operations oversee processes, resources, and workflows to help organizations run smoothly and achieve their goals. Their responsibilities can range from supply chain management and logistics to process improvement and team coordination. Operations roles are essential across many industries, including manufacturing, retail, healthcare, and technology. These positions require strong organizational, problem-solving, and communication skills.

    Role: - Pharma Product Manager

    Location: - Remote

    JD:-Pharma domain Software Product Manager

    • We are seeking an experienced Software Product Manager to lead product strategy, discovery, and delivery for software solutions supporting pharma pre-clinical, clinical and manufacturing operations. The ideal candidate brings 8+ years of industry experience, including direct experience in pharma or in a product management role serving pharma, with a strong understanding of clinical trials or manufacturing processes, regulated environments, and enterprise platforms, operating at the intersection of technology, pharma operations, and compliance. You will help shape products that improve manufacturing efficiency, support regulatory readiness, and deliver measurable business value for life sciences organizations.

     Responsibilities

    • Define product strategy and roadmap for software products supporting pharma manufacturing and operations.
    • Lead end-to-end product development from concept through launch and continuous improvement.
    • Work closely with engineering, design, QA, operations, and business stakeholders to translate business needs into clear product requirements.
    • Gather, prioritize, author, and manage product requirements, user stories, and acceptance criteria.
    • Collaborate with geographically distributed cross-functional teams across time zones.
    • Ensure solutions align with pharma manufacturing workflows, compliance expectations, and enterprise system integrations (e.g. ERP, SCADA, LIMS).
    • Partner with stakeholders to support product adoption, training, and release readiness.
    • Track product performance, gather feedback, and use data to guide roadmap decisions.

     Required Qualifications

    • 8+ years of overall industry experience.
    • Experience in pharma, life sciences, or a product management role supporting pharma-related solutions.
    • Strong knowledge of pharma manufacturing processes and operational workflows.
    • Familiarity with regulatory requirements, including FDA, EMA and MHRA regulations.
    • Experience working with or delivering products in the context of MES, LES, QMS, and CMMS, CTMS, IRT platforms.
    • Hands-on experience with product management tools such as Jira and Aha.
    • Proven ability to work effectively with distributed teams across multiple locations and functions.
    • Demonstrated experience building a product from scratch, from ideation to launch.
    • Strong communication, stakeholder management, and problem-solving skills.
